I'm afraid I still do not get it. What's so inferior to depend on some
file (relative to ${LOCALBASE}) if that's what really required? While I
understand that BUILD_DEPENDS lines might look longer than LIB_DEPENDS
ones, but that's only because BUILD_DEPENDS are inherently special: while
LIB_DEPENDS item is clearly defined shared library with standard usage
semantics, BUILD_DEPENDS generally cannot be implemented that concisely,
because we do not apriori know exactly which file a port depends on,
thus -- fully qualified path. Technically it seems excessive (e.g.
while BUILD_DEPENDS is defined, all provided files are installed), but
it is useful to keep track of what port needs, and it makes easier to
adjust _DEPENDS later as appropriate. This is what I've been trying to
enforce for quite a long time: out ports should be stateful. Right now,
it is often required to deeply examine the port itself (CVS history) and
original vendor's sources to get a clue what's exactly going on, quite
often because of incorrect dependencies records!

As I see it, the whole issue (in general case) boils down to this:
- If port (not its dependencies!) installs executable that dynamically
links to a libfoo.so, add libfoo.so provider port to LIB_DEPENDS
- If port loads shared object via dlopen(3) -- add it to RUN_DEPENDS.
Adding this library as LIB_DEPENDS won't save you from ABI breakage
anyways; either port maintainer (or, better, upstream author) should
keep track of these issues to ensure everything is nice and dainty.
Last but not least: dlopen(3) is runtime thing, so LIB_DEPENDS is
wrong from common sense (we presume that ports framework does not
contradict common sense; if it does, we're in a much worse trouble)
- If both configure script *and* build require some header file or
statically links to an archive (*.a) -- set BUILD_DEPENDS accordingly
- If configure script *bogusly* requires something (we all know how
crappy this autotools generated stuff can be) -- patch the script
